EPA and Army Corps Release New WOTUS Rule

The Energy Law

On September 8, 2023, EPA and the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ers published a final rule narrowing the scope of “waters of the United States” (WOTUS) under the Clean Water Act (CWA) such that certain wetlands are removed from federal jurisdiction. Louisiana’s Future in Offshore Wind: Takeaways from Louisiana Wind Week

The Energy Law

Last week, the Louisiana Governor’s Office hosted Louisiana Wind Week 2021 to assess Louisiana’s future in offshore wind energy development. Louisiana Wind Week followed the Bureau of Ocean Energy Management (BOEM)’s first Gulf of Mexico Intergovernmental Renewable Energy Task Force meeting, which was held on June 15.
